SN74ALS32DE4 Specifications

  • Type
    Parameter
  • Package / Case
    14-SOIC (0.154", 3.90mm Width)
  • Supplier Device Package
    14-SOIC
  • Mounting Type
    Surface Mount
  • Operating Temperature
    0°C ~ 70°C
  • Max Propagation Delay @ V, Max CL
    14ns @ 5V, 50pF
  • Input Logic Level - High
    2V
  • Input Logic Level - Low
    0.8V
  • Current - Output High, Low
    400µA, 8mA
  • Current - Quiescent (Max)
    -
  • Voltage - Supply
    4.5V ~ 5.5V
  • Features
    -
  • Number of Inputs
    2
  • Number of Circuits
    4
  • Logic Type
    OR Gate
  • Packaging
    Tube
  • Product Status
    Last Time Buy
  • Series
    74ALS
The SN74ALS32DE4 is a specific integrated circuit chip manufactured by Texas Instruments. It is a quad 2-input positive-OR gate, belonging to the ALS (Advanced Low-Power Schottky) family. Here are some advantages and application scenarios of this chip:Advantages: 1. High-speed operation: The ALS technology used in this chip allows for fast switching speeds, making it suitable for applications that require quick response times. 2. Low power consumption: The ALS family is known for its low-power characteristics, making the SN74ALS32DE4 an energy-efficient choice. 3. Wide operating voltage range: This chip can operate within a wide voltage range, typically between 4.5V and 5.5V, providing flexibility in various applications. 4. Robustness: The SN74ALS32DE4 is designed to be resistant to noise and interference, ensuring reliable performance in challenging environments.Application scenarios: 1. Logic gates: The SN74ALS32DE4 is commonly used in digital logic circuits to perform OR gate functions. It can be used to combine multiple input signals and generate an output based on their logical OR operation. 2. Data processing: This chip can be employed in data processing systems, such as arithmetic units or data multiplexers, where logical operations are required. 3. Control systems: The SN74ALS32DE4 can be utilized in control systems to implement decision-making logic, enabling the system to respond to different input conditions. 4. Communication systems: It can be used in communication systems for signal routing and switching purposes, allowing for efficient data transmission.Remember to consult the datasheet and application notes provided by Texas Instruments for detailed information on the chip's specifications, recommended operating conditions, and design considerations.
